The Information Security team within ITB is a highly specialized group of cyber security professionals tasked to oversee the defense and response of cyber security incidents within NYPD. This includes, but not limited to, user access and controls, vulnerability, scanning, cyber threat intelligence gathering, and incident response.
The Information Security Office seeks an IT Security Specialist. Job duties include:
o Research current and emerging threats facing the business and industry sector.
o Track threat actor infrastructure and associated malware families.
o Centralize multiple threat sources (premium, industry-shared, open-source, dark web), correlate indicators and threats, and distill actionable intelligence.
o Use automation to efficiently streamline and de-duplicate threats for playbooks, but use human analysis for actionable decision-making.
o Actively hunt for exposures and identify incidents warranting action to disrupt and remediate threats.
o Use and assign indicator severity and impact ratings to determine appropriate plans of action.
o Document threats into contextual reports outlining severity, urgency and impact, and ensure they can be understood by both management and technical teams.
o Serve as a trusted advisor to establish credibility with business unit leadership and technical teams.
o Share relevant information with stakeholders and make recommendations for next steps when facing threats.
o Actively participate in threat hunting tabletop exercises to hone and strengthen skills across the team.
o Evaluate and implement deception techniques designed to thwart adversaries.
o Work closely with security leadership to instill cybersecurity policies and practices throughout business units to address security operations, incident response, application security and infrastructure.
o Actively inform and engage in security projects across the business to disrupt active or potential threats.
o Be readily available to participate in collaborative threat analysis meetings with internal and external trusted entities.
o Maintain an up-to-date level of knowledge related to security threats, vulnerabilities and mitigations to reduce attack surface, and circulate it through business units.
o Motivate business units to adopt cybersecurity controls to reduce attack surface.
o Openly support the CISCO, management team and executive leadership, even during tumultuous times.
o Perform other duties as assigned.

Preferred Skills
-Applicants should have several years of cyber security experience with a specialization in intelligence gathering, and an applicable knowledge of adversary tactics, MITRE ATT&CK framework, OSINT and proficiency with commercial and open source cyber-threat intelligence tools. - Applicants should also possess strong administrative, verbal and written communication skills. -Bachelor's or Master's degree and CISSP, GCIH, GCTI certificate are preferred (certificates should be valid and current). * Familiarity with administering directory services, Windows and Azure AD, SSO, MFA and role-based access control (RBAC). * Experience administering IAM systems, access controls, security and risk management, and security governance fundamentals. * Ideally familiar with one or more regulatory requirements and laws such as, but not limited to, PCI, Federal Financial Institutions Examination Council (FFIEC), Sarbanes-Oxley (SOX), HIPAA, GDPR and GLBA. Additionally, experience in one or more of the following preferred: ISO 17799, ITIL and NIST. * Preferable experience with one or more scripting languages (e.g., Python, PowerShell, Bash). * Track record acting with integrity, taking pride in work, seeking to excel, and being curious and flexible. * Strong written and oral communication skills across varying levels of the organization. * Understanding of service design, delivery concepts and control frameworks.
